Subject: Soft deletes now live in orders table

Team,

Starting with this release, rows in the Fernwick Commerce orders table are no longer hard-deleted. Deletions set deleted_at and the row stays put. All read paths in the Larkspur service filter these out by default; if you're writing a new query, remember to do the same. Backfill of historical tombstones finished last night with no anomalies. The build that shipped this is identified below.

trace token, fafog-kageg: htk4_98e6

Handover — CSV Import Wizard (Fennwick Toolkit)

For plugin authors: the wizard now validates headers before invoking your hooks, so drop any duplicate checks. Delimiter sniffing is still fragile with semicolons; patch pending. Test fixtures live in the sandbox tenant. To unlock the sandbox, use the recovery passphrase given below.

unlock words, fahop-yageg: ralwyn-kelath

Subject: Quickstore 4.2 — bloom filter now fronts the KV layer

Plugin authors: starting with this release, Quickstore places a bloom filter ahead of the key-value store. Negative lookups return faster; false positives fall through safely. No API changes are required on your side. Verify your plugin against the staging build referenced below.

session token of fahif-tadup = htk3_9c7

This release introduces Tilewarden, the map-tile prefetcher that warms the edge cache ahead of forecasted traffic. It replaces the nightly bulk-pull job, which should be disabled in the scheduler before rollout to avoid duplicate fetches. Prefetch regions are derived from the prior week's demand model and refreshed hourly. Roll out to one region first, confirm cache hit rates improve, then proceed. As release manager, record sign-off once the prefetcher starts with the service configuration values shown below.

settings of fadup-kajog:
[casox]
port = 3000
team = jorix
host = casox.paliqio.example
region = lower-4
access_code = ac_dd069a
timeout_ms = 750